Realms Plus were first announced on September 28, 2019, during MINECON Live 2019. Exclusive to Bedrock Edition, it's a subscription-based service, much like Java Edition Realms, in which players can create 10-player private servers from either their own world or a catalog of content from the Marketplace. It was officially released on December 3, replacing the original 10-player Realms, while remaining the 2-player version intact. This logo is still used in Bedrock Edition, in the Realms Plus section of the Marketplace.

On September 7th 2021, an article was published, with this look being present in the header image. It was the same as the previous logo, only the then-new Minecraft core brand logo replaced the old one. However, in the November 2nd article, it was reverted to the older logo, then the December 7th one replaced it with a newer, proper logo.
